*NITA Getting there, but more through animal lovers yet all the time there are more and more animal advocacy groups forming in this country. Sadly, though, many religious groups – priests and nuns- in the Catholic Church are still lacking in elevated consciousness about the rights of animals. Abolitionist: Will you tell us the story about Cardinal Jaime Sin as he sounds like a character. *NITA: Indeed he is! Jaime Cardinal Sin (that’s his official name) was loved and hated at the same time because he was a meddler in politics. He was a leading figure in the Edsa Revolution movement that unseated the dictator Ferdinand Marcos. Since he was so prominent in the public eye, I decided to write him a letter, asking for his endorsement of church blessings of animals every October.
